Abstract

Systems and methods for searching for objects located in a virtual world include having a virtual construct such as a bot crawl the virtual world by moving from place to place. Object information is collected about the objects associated with the place and the object information is stored in a searchable database. Users can search the database for objects in the virtual world. The information can be further filtered or classified to aid in searching.

Claims

1 . A method of searching a virtual world for objects, the method comprising
 providing a virtual construct capable of existence within the virtual world, wherein the virtual world has at least three dimensions;   instructing the virtual construct to search for objects according to a search criteria;   moving the virtual construct to a place within the virtual world, wherein the place is at least defined by a finite two-dimensional area within the virtual world;   allowing the virtual construct to obtain object information relating to a plurality of objects within the place that match the search criteria;   storing at least some of the object information in a searchable database; and   providing a computer interface through which a user can submit an object query to the searchable database to search for objects.   
     
     
         2 . The method of  claim 1 , wherein the step of allowing the virtual construct to obtain object information includes instructing the virtual construct to obtain object information external to the virtual world. 
     
     
         3 . The method of  claim 2 , wherein the object information resides on an Internet accessible site that is unaffiliated with an owner of the virtual world. 
     
     
         4 . The method of  claim 1 , wherein the step of moving the virtual construct to the place includes migrating the virtual construct to a centroid of a cluster of the plurality of objects. 
     
     
         5 . The method of  claim 1 , wherein the step of moving the virtual construct to the place includes placing the virtual object at a Z-position other than ground level, and wherein the place is defined by a finite three-dimensional area within the virtual world. 
     
     
         6 . The method of  claim 1 , wherein the search criteria includes a programmed path used to guide the virtual construct in the step of moving the virtual construct to the place. 
     
     
         7 . The method of  claim 1 , wherein the step of allowing the object to obtain object information includes establishing a communication between the virtual construct and at least one of the plurality of objects via a robot information control protocol. 
     
     
         8 . The method of  claim 1 , further comprising presenting a result set to the user in response to the object query where the result set is ranked. 
     
     
         9 . The method of  claim 8 , further comprising ranking the result set according to an object popularity. 
     
     
         10 . The method of  claim 9 , wherein the object popularity is calculated based on a Hidden Markov Model. 
     
     
         11 . The method of  claim 9 , further comprising ranking the result set according to a creator popularity. 
     
     
         12 . The method of  claim 9 , further comprising ranking the result set according to a recommendation based on a preference of a social peer in a social network. 
     
     
         13 . The method of  claim 9 , further comprising ranking the result set by a sales price. 
     
     
         14 . The method of  claim 1 , further comprising removing object information from the database based on the search criteria. 
     
     
         15 . The method of  claim 1 , wherein the database is located on a computer system unaffiliated with an owner of the virtual world. 
     
     
         16 . The method of  claim 1 , wherein the object information comprises an image, an attribute, and an object name. 
     
     
         17 . The method of  claim 16 , further comprising classifying the place as a function of a ratio of objects having the attribute to objects lacking the attribute. 
     
     
         18 . The method of  claim 17 , wherein the place is classified as a commercial zone based upon a minimum threshold number of objects for sale within the place. 
     
     
         19 . The method of  claim 16 , wherein the attribute includes a creator defined attribute defined by a creator of an object of the plurality of objects. 
     
     
         20 . The method of  claim 1 , further comprising validating at least one of the plurality of objects as an authorized object. 
     
     
         21 . The method of  claim 20 , further comprising instructing the at least one of the plurality of objects to perform an authorized action that is detectable by the virtual construct.
